Your child will be entitled to free school transport to the nearest school to your home address, or the school designated to serve your home address, as long as it is more than three miles away from your home by the shortest walking route. Students in Devon have been warned they must wear a face covering when travelling on a school bus - or face being thrown off. A spokesperson for DCC said: ''If a student is found not wearing a face covering by the school or transport operator on two occasions, and there is no record of them being exempt from using one, they will be refused travel for a period of time.''. .
